Fantasy Football S10 WEEK 29 Round Up

I TELL YAH INVITATIONAL LEAGUE

SEASON TEN

WEEK 29

This week, in a reduced Premier League schedule of just four games, Fulham destroyed Spurs 3-0 at home, while Burnley defeated Brentford 2-1 at home. Aston Villa drew 1-1 at West Ham, and Notts Forest drew 1-1 at Luton.

In the ITYFL, with just four games, points were at a premium. But it’s much to the benefit of league leader Sanjay Beecher, who stays top via just two points thanks to his free hit, 20 point week. With main contributions from captain Son (4), the only player to earn more than two points.

My middle son Jahsiah Tobierrie moves into second place due to his free hit, 27 point weekly score, thanks to captain Son (4) Gibbs-White (7) and Martinez (5).

This week’s joint Highest Mover is the defending two-time champ Jeff Franklin, who moved up two places from 5th to 3rd, following his free hit weekly score of 28 points, with contributions from captain Son (4) Wood (9) and Gibbs-White (7).

Owen Barnes moved down to fourth, losing ground due to an 11 point weekly score. With only captain Son (4) providing any significant points.

Former double champ, Danny Milton is down to fifth, following his weekly score of 15 points, due to captain Son (4) and Areola (3). My oldest son, under his alias Tommy Devito, loses some ground in sixth place due to his 8 point week, contributed by just three players. Captain Watkins (4) Areola (3), and Douglas Luiz (1).

My coaching partner Francis Norville remains seventh due to his free hit, 19 point weekly score. With only Areola (3) scoring more than two points. In eighth is this week’s Highest Scorer, former champ, ahem Charles Denton, thanks to a weekly score of 38 points. Doing the business were captain Son (4) Robinson (11) Coufal (7), and Martinez (5).

Staying in ninth is my youngest son Latrell Oscar, following his 24 point weekly score, with only Gibbs-White (7) scoring more then two points. Moving into the top ten is my blood brother Wayne Watson following his wildcard 19 point week. Only Andreas (3) scoring more than two points.

This week’s other Highest Mover was Washington DC’s Greg Cabana, who moved up two places from 13th to 11th thanks to his free hit, 28 point weekly score, with only Coufal (7) scoring more than two points.
